package org.apache.directory.api.ldap.extras.extended.certGeneration;
import org.apache.directory.api.ldap.model.message.AbstractExtendedRequest;
/**
*
* An extended operation requesting the server to generate a public/private key pair and a certificate
* and store them in a specified target entry in the DIT.
*
* @author <a href="mailto:dev@directory.apache.org">Apache Directory Project</a>
*/
public class CertGenerationRequestImpl extends AbstractExtendedRequest implements CertGenerationRequest
{
/** the Dn of the server entry which will be updated*/
private String targetDN;
/** the issuer Dn that will be set in the certificate*/
private String issuerDN;
/** the Dn of the subject that is present in the certificate*/
private String subjectDN;
/** name of the algorithm used for generating the keys*/
private String keyAlgorithm;
/**
* Creates a new instance of CertGenerationRequest.
*
* @param messageId the message id
* @param targerDN the Dn of target entry whose key and certificate values will be changed
* @param issuerDN Dn to be used as the issuer's Dn in the certificate
* @param subjectDN Dn to be used as certificate's subject
* @param keyAlgorithm crypto algorithm name to be used for generating the keys
*/
public CertGenerationRequestImpl( int messageId, String targerDN, String issuerDN, String subjectDN,
String keyAlgorithm )
{
super( messageId );
setRequestName( EXTENSION_OID );
this.targetDN = targerDN;
this.issuerDN = issuerDN;
this.subjectDN = subjectDN;
this.keyAlgorithm = keyAlgorithm;
}
/**
* Creates a new instance of CertGenerationRequest.
*/
public CertGenerationRequestImpl()
{
setRequestName( EXTENSION_OID );
}
